Ingredients:

  • 8 ounces cream cheese, softened
  • 1/2 cup mayonnaise
  • 2 cans (6 ounces each) tuna, drained
  • 1/4 cup finely chopped onion
  • 2 tablespoons finely chopped celery
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 1/2 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ce
  • 1/4 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on dried dill
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ions:

In a medium bowl, beat the cream cheese until smooth. Add the mayonnaise and mix until well combined. Stir in the tuna, onion, celery, lemon juice, Worcestershire sauce, garlic powder, and dried dill.

Season with salt and pepper to taste. Cover and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to allow the flavors to meld.

When ready to serve, transfer the fish spread to a serving dish. Serve with crackers, toasted bread, or fresh vegetables. The chilled, creamy texture and subtle flavors make this fish spread a delightful appetizer that's sure to be a hit.

How Long Does Paprykarz Last Once Opened?

Once you've opened that tasty jar, you'll want to know how long it'll stay fresh, right?

Well, generally speaking, an opened jar of the good stuff will last 3-5 days in the fridge. Just keep it sealed up tight and it'll stay yummy.

After that, it's best to toss it – you don't want any funky flavors creeping in.
